FRONT Exhibitions Extended Beyond September 30

September 25, 2018General

The majority of exhibitions presented as part of the inaugural exhibition of FRONT International, An American City, close on September 30. A select few exhibitions will remain. View the list below and continue to enjoy FRONT’s legacy long after the initial exhibition closes – exhibitions are listed in order of closing date:

 

October 7
Cleveland Institute of Art, Great Lakes Research

 

October 21
Cleveland Museum of Art, Kerry James Marshall
James and Hanna Bartlett Prints and Drawings Gallery | Gallery 101

 

December 2
Cleveland Museum of Art, Allen Ruppersberg
Julia and Larry Pollock Focus Gallery | Gallery 010

 

December 16
Allen Memorial Art Museum, Oberlin College, Barbara Bloom

 

December 30
Cleveland Museum of Art, Marlon de Azambuja and Luisa Lambri
Betty T. and David M. Schneider Gallery | Gallery 218

 

December 2018
Federal Reserve Bank, Philip Vanderhyden, Volatility Smile 

 

Ongoing 
Toby’s Plaza at Case Western Reserve University, Tony Tasset, Judy’s Hand Pavillion
